[Bug 1583849] Re: dist-upgrade & FF upgrade breaks FF & Midori 16.04 PPC
Hi, On my powermac G5, running Lubuntu 16.04, I downgraded firefox to 45.02, and it worked again (I'm currently using it). [Bug 1516224] [NEW] Backlight control does not work on Eee PC 1005p with Ubuntu 15.10
Public bug reported: Hi, The unity backlight control still changes the value of /sys/class/backlight/eeepc/brightness, but the 4.2 kernel that comes with Ubuntu 15.10 uses /sys/class/backlight/intel_backlight/brightness instead. When I change/sys/class/backlight/intel_backlight/brightness manually, the backlight changes. If I boot the Eee PC with a 3.13 kernel, /sys/class/backlight/eeepc/brightness is used, and the backlight control from unity works.
